Question 2 1 pts Crossroad Corporation is trying to decide whether to invest to automate a production line. If the project is accepted, labor costs will decrease by $600,000 per year. However, other cash operating expenses will increase by $169,000 per year. The equipment will cost $210,000 and is depreciable over 11 years using simplified straight line to a zero salvage value. Crossroad will invest $8,000 in net working capital at installation. The firm has a marginal tax rate of 34%. Calculate the firm's annual cash flows associated with the new project.
